Amphibious Excavators for Swampy Conditions

Heavy machinery plays a crucial role in various construction and excavation projects. However, when dealing with swampy conditions, traditional excavators often fall short. This is where amphibious excavators come into play, offering a unique set of capabilities to navigate and work effectively in these challenging terrains.

Amphibious excavators are specialized machines designed for operation in both land and water environments. They are equipped with unique features that allow them to traverse difficult terrain, making them invaluable in a wide range of industries, from construction and agriculture to environmental remediation.

This article delves into the specifics of amphibious excavators, highlighting their capabilities, types, applications, and the advantages they offer over traditional excavators in swampy conditions.

Understanding Amphibious Excavator Capabilities

The key to an amphibious excavator's success lies in its unique design. These machines are built to excel in both aquatic and terrestrial environments. Unlike their land-based counterparts, they are equipped with:

Specialized Chassis and Suspension

  • Elevated ground clearance: This allows them to navigate over uneven surfaces and through shallow water with ease.
  • Robust suspension systems: These systems are designed to handle the unique stresses of both land and water, ensuring stability and preventing damage.
  • Watertight compartments: Critical components are housed in watertight compartments to protect them from water damage during operation in aquatic environments.

Advanced Propulsion Systems

  • Powerful engines: The engines are typically more powerful than standard excavators to handle the extra load and resistance in water.
  • Dual propulsion systems: These excavators often feature both land-based and water-based propulsion systems, allowing them to transition between environments smoothly.
  • Specialized water jets: Water jets are often included to aid in maneuvering and movement in water.

Types of Amphibious Excavators

Different applications necessitate different types of amphibious excavators. The choice depends heavily on the specific needs of the project.

Crawler-Based Excavators

  • These excavators are ideal for more challenging terrains and heavier lifting tasks.
  • Their robust chassis and tracks provide excellent stability on both land and water.

Wheeled Amphibious Excavators

  • Wheeled excavators are more maneuverable on land and offer greater speed.
  • They are often better suited for lighter-duty applications in less demanding swampy conditions.

Applications in Swampy Environments

The versatility of amphibious excavators makes them highly valuable in a range of industries. They are instrumental in:

Construction and Infrastructure Projects

  • Canal and waterway construction: Excavating and shaping the terrain in aquatic environments.
  • Swamp drainage projects: Removing excess water for land development.
  • Foundation work in wetlands: Preparing the ground for building projects in difficult terrain.

Agriculture and Forestry

  • Clearing land for farming: Removing vegetation and preparing the ground for agricultural activities.
  • Maintaining irrigation systems: Excavating and repairing irrigation channels.

Environmental Remediation

  • Removing contaminated materials: Working in hazardous swampy areas to remove pollutants.
  • Restoring wetlands: Rehabilitating and shaping wetlands for environmental restoration.

Advantages and Disadvantages

While amphibious excavators offer significant advantages, there are also considerations to make.

Advantages

  • Increased efficiency: They can complete tasks faster and more efficiently in swampy conditions.
  • Improved safety: They provide a safer working environment in hazardous terrains.
  • Reduced project costs: They can often streamline the process and reduce the overall project costs.

Disadvantages

  • Higher initial cost: The specialized design and technology lead to a higher purchase price.
  • Maintenance requirements: The complexity of the machinery demands specialized maintenance.
  • Limited maneuverability on extremely uneven terrain: They may not always be ideal for the most extreme conditions.

Amphibious excavators represent a significant advancement in heavy machinery technology, offering a unique solution for working in challenging swampy terrains. Their specialized design, advanced propulsion systems, and versatility make them invaluable in construction, agriculture, and environmental remediation projects. While there are some associated costs and maintenance requirements, the efficiency gains and safety advantages often outweigh these factors, making them a worthwhile investment for projects in difficult environments.
